The Bird & The Bee (feat. Beck) – Hot For Teacher
Inara George is the daughter of Little Feat’s Lowell George, and Greg Kurstin produced everyone from Lily Allen, Sia and Adele to Beck, Kendrick Lamar and Foo Fighters. In 2004, Kurstin contributed piano to several tracks on George’s solo debut. It was then they laid the foundation for The Bird & The Bee, a jazz-influenced electro-pop project.
Since their 2006 debut EP Again And Again And Again And Again, they released four full albums. One of them was Interpreting The Masters Volume 1: A Tribute To Daryl Hall & John Oates. No need to explain the concept of that album, I presume?
As you could also have guessed from the title, The Bird & The Bee intended to give more acts their re-interpretation treatment. Well, on 2 August, Interpreting The Masters Volume 2: A Tribute To Van Halen will see the light of day. Ahead of it, they already released their versions of Panama and Ain’t Talking ‘bout Love, but I like their new single Hot For Teacher the best. Not in the least because of the teacher, impersonated by Beck. The original version is from Van Halen’s album 1984.
